chorea

English dictionary entry

Meanings

noun
  1. An Ancient Greek circular dance accompanied by a chorus.
  2. Any of the various diseases of the nervous system characterized by involuntary muscular movements of the face and extremities; St. Vitus's dance.

Etymology

From Ancient Greek χορεία (khoreía).
